What is the kinetic energy of an athlete (m75kg) while running a 10 seconds 100m dash assume constant speed?

The kinetic energy of the athlete can be calculated using the formula KE = 0.5 * m * v^2, where m = mass of the athlete (75 kg) and v = speed. Since the athlete is running at a constant speed over 100m in 10 seconds, we can calculate the speed using distance/time. The speed is 10 m/s. Plugging these values into the formula, the kinetic energy of the athlete is 3750 Joules.

What is the speed if I run 100m in 10 seconds?

To find the speed, you can use the formula: speed = distance/time. If you run 100 meters in 10 seconds, your speed would be 100 meters divided by 10 seconds, which equals 10 meters per second. Therefore, your speed is 10 m/s.

A bird flies 150m for 10 secondsthen 200m for 10 secondsand then 100m for 5 seconds What is the bird's average speed?

The total distance covered by the bird is 450m (150m + 200m + 100m) and the total time taken is 25 seconds (10 seconds + 10 seconds + 5 seconds). Therefore, the average speed of the bird is 18 m/s (450m / 25s).
